Sorting is the variability in grain size in a clastic sedimentary rock. This parameter measures how well a sediment has been ‘sorted’ by the process that transported it. A sediment can be: – very well sorted: nearly all grains have the same size. – well sorted: most grains fall in a single grain size class with few outliers.

WebA rock must meet all of these requirements to be considered breccia: Clastic Sedimentary – Formed from the cementing together of rock and mineral fragments; Coarse-grained – A significant portion of the rock consists of large (over 2 mm) grains; Poorly Sorted – Highly variable grain sizes, ranging from sand to pebbles or cobbles WebFigure \(\PageIndex{1}\): Well-sorted sediment (left) and Poorly-sorted sediment (right). When reading the story told by rocks, geologists use sorting to interpret erosion or transport processes, as well as deposition energy. For example, wind-blown sands are typically extremely well sorted, while glacial deposits are typically poorly sorted. chrome pc antigo https://ltdesign-craft.com

Conglomerates and breccias are sedimentary rocks composed of coarse fragments of preexisting rocks held together either by cement or by a finer-grained clastic matrix.Both contain significant amounts (at least 10 percent) of coarser-than-sand-size clasts.
